Common Axe28x1.exe Errors on Windows

Dealing with axe28x1.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with axe28x1.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.

  • Runtime Errors: This warning is displayed when there's an issue with a program while it's being executed. This might be caused by software glitches, uncontrolled memory consumption, or conflicting actions with other active software.
  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This warning is shown when the application fails to start as it should, typically caused by an inconsistency between the 32-bit and 64-bit versions of the application and the Windows operating system.
  •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error surfaces when a program cannot be initiated because it's not compatible with the version of Windows being used, or the file itself might be corrupt.
  • Access is Denied: This warning pops up when the system denies access to a particular file or resource. Reasons could include limited user permissions, complications with file ownership, or strict file permissions.
  • Missing Axe28x1.exe File: This warning is displayed when the desired executable file cannot be found by the system. This can happen if axe28x1.exe has been moved, deleted, or if the file path given is erroneous.
